Experience ultimate oceanfront relaxation at The Surf Club Condominiums! This fractional ownership opportunity (1/4) presents a stunning ocean-view condo mere steps away from pristine Dewey Beach and the Atlantic Ocean. Owners enjoy up to 12 weeks (1 week per month) to either vacation in their unit or capitalize on rental opportunities. Fully furnished and turnkey, this recently updated unit sleeps up to 4, boasting a king-size bed, a spacious sofa with a queen-size pull-out bed, dresser, closet, and a Flat Screen TV. The well-equipped kitchenette features a refrigerator/freezer, an induction stove (2 burners), a microwave, coffee maker, and more. The bathroom offers a walk-in shower, a hairdryer, extra storage, daily fresh towels, and toiletries. As a Surf Club owner, you'll have a quarterly fractional share with one week per month for personal use, sharing with family, friends, or renting out. On-site management oversees the unit and building, as well as the management of rentals. The condo fee covers comprehensive amenities such as insurance, water, sewer, taxes, electric, heat, A/C, internet, cable TV, custodial services, and general maintenance of the building and outdoor pool. It also includes one assigned parking space. This is the ideal spot to be in the heart of Dewey Beach! Embrace everything Dewey Beach has to offer without the stress.
